I remember seeing Garth Brooks in concert when he brought his tour to the William R. Johnson Coliseum on the campus of SFA in Nacogdoches.  Martina McBride was his opening act, and the concert was sold out and a huge success.  Garth was phenomenal.

He also was in concert in Nacogdoches a few years earlier at a club called Bullwinkles.  Granted, Garth was just starting to get his career rolling, but what an opportunity that was...to see someone with Garth's talent and showmanship on a dive bar stage.  That's something that will never happen again...or will it?

Earlier in the Summer, Garth Brooks announced that he would be doing 7 'Dive Bar' tour stops to promote his new single.  The venues are no where near the coliseums he used to packing.  These are bars that have a capacity of somewhere between 500-1000 folk.  His first stop was at Joe's on Weed Street in Chicago, next was Buck Owens' Crystal Palace in Bakersfield, California, and his third stop will be at historic Gruene Hall near New Braunfels, Texas on Monday, September 23rd.
